A First Look at Virgil Abloh & Nike’s “QUEEN” Collaboration for Serena Williams
Featuring performance gear and new takes on the Air Max 97 & Blazer Mid.











After teasing the collaboration recently, Nike and Virgil Abloh have now revealed their joint “QUEEN” capsule for Serena Williams. Coming two weeks before Williams steps out on-court at the U.S. Open, the collection features two tulled dresses — “daytime” and “nighttime” — as well as special-edition performance sneakers.
The dresses both feature signature Abloh touches, with the “LOGO” branding from previous collaborative Nike releases as well as the word “SERENA.” This text also features on the special-edition NikeCourt Flare 2 PE silhouette. As well as the performance pieces, the capsule also includes a bomber jacket and bag. The collection will also launch alongside special editions of the Air Max 97 and Blazer Mid SW. The 97s come in a bright pink colorway while the Blazer’s are decked out in grey. Both sneakers feature a colorful gradient midsole.
Abloh also explained his ideas behind the collaboration: ”With Serena, we have one of our generation’s most powerful, inspiring athletes as the muse. I was trying to embody her spirit and bring something compelling and fresh to tennis. What I love about tennis is the gracefulness. It’s an aggressive and powerful game, but it takes touch and finesse. So the dress is feminine, but combines her aggression. It’s partially revealing. It’s asymmetrical. It has a sort of ballerina-esque silhouette to symbolize her grace. It’s not about bells and whistles and tricks. It’s just about it living on the body, and expressing Serena’s spirit with each swing of the racket.”
Pricing for the collection is as follows:
Nike x Virgil Abloh for Serena Williams Dress – Day and Night colorway: $500 USD
Nike x Virgil Abloh for Serena Williams Jacket: $900 USD
Nike x Off-White NikeCourt Flare: TBA
The Ten: Nike Air Max 97 – Serena inspired colorway: $190 USD
The Ten: Nike Blazer – Serena inspired colorway: $130 USD
This is Abloh’s second sports-influenced collaboration with Nike, following the World Cup capsule earlier this year.
